Understanding Baking Enzymes

Baking enzymes are biological catalysts that can be derived from various sources, including plants, fungi, and bacteria. They play a crucial role in breaking down starches and proteins, which can significantly improve the texture and rise of gluten-free products. For instance, amylase is an enzyme that breaks down starches into sugars, which yeast can then ferment to produce carbon dioxide, creating that delightful airy quality many of us crave in baked goods. As a result, the inclusion of safe and effective baking enzymes can lead to a significant enhancement in the quality of gluten-free bread and pastries.
